The postcode PO12 1PS is located in Gosport, in the county of Hampsh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PO12 1PS is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

PO12 1PS is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PO12 1PS as Hard-pressed living > Challenged terraced workers > Deprived blue-collar terraces.

The closest road name to PO12 1PS is Bevis Road which is centered 12 m away.

The nearest bus stop is St Vincent College and is 352 m away. The closest railway station is Portsmouth Harbour Rail Station, 2.03 km away.

The closest primary school to PO12 1PS (for ages 11 and under) is Newtown Church of England Voluntary Controlled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 20,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Bay House School. The last OFSTED inspection on October 17,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of PO12 1PS is Queens Hotel and is 142 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on February 26,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Joyes Chicken and is 352 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 8,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 106 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.3 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.7 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for PO12 1PS is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Hampsh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
